      piix4/ich9: do not raise SMI on ACPI enable/disable commands · afd6895b
      Paolo Bonzini 提交于
      These commands are handled entirely by QEMU.  Do not raise an SMI
      when they happen, because Windows (at least 2008r2) expects these
      commands to work and (depending on the value of APMC_EN at
      startup) the firmware might not have installed an SMI handler.
      
      When this happens (e.g. the kernel supports SMIs, or you are using
      TCG, but you have used "-machine smm=off") RIP is moved to 0x38000
      where there is no code to execute.

      exec: skip MMIO regions correctly in cpu_physical_memory_write_rom_internal · b242e0e0
      Paolo Bonzini 提交于
      Loading the BIOS in the mac99 machine is interesting, because there is a
      PROM in the middle of the BIOS region (from 16K to 32K).  Before memory
      region accesses were clamped, when QEMU was asked to load a BIOS from
      0xfff00000 to 0xffffffff it would put even those 16K from the BIOS file
      into the region.  This is weird because those 16K were not actually
      visible between 0xfff04000 and 0xfff07fff.  However, it worked.
      
      After clamping was added, this also worked.  In this case, the
      cpu_physical_memory_write_rom_internal function split the write in
      three parts: the first 16K were copied, the PROM area (second 16K) were
      ignored, then the rest was copied.
      
      Problems then started with commit 965eb2fc (exec: do not clamp accesses
      to MMIO regions, 2015-06-17).  Clamping accesses is not done for MMIO
      regions because they can overlap wildly, and MMIO registers can be
      expected to perform full-width accesses based only on their address
      (with no respect for adjacent registers that could decode to completely
      different MemoryRegions).  However, this lack of clamping also applied
      to the PROM area!  cpu_physical_memory_write_rom_internal thus failed
      to copy the third range above, i.e. only copied the first 16K of the BIOS.
      
      In effect, address_space_translate is expecting _something else_ to do
      the clamping for MMIO regions if the incoming length is large.  This
      "something else" is memory_access_size in the case of address_space_rw,
      so use the same logic in cpu_physical_memory_write_rom_internal.

      Stop including qemu-common.h in memory.h · fba0a593
      Peter Maydell 提交于
      Including qemu-common.h from other header files is generally a bad
      idea, because it means it's very easy to end up with a circular
      dependency. For instance, if we wanted to include memory.h from
      qom/cpu.h we'd end up with this loop:
       memory.h -> qemu-common.h -> cpu.h -> cpu-qom.h -> qom/cpu.h -> memory.h
      
      Remove the include from memory.h. This requires us to fix up a few
      other files which were inadvertently getting declarations indirectly
      through memory.h.
      
      The biggest change is splitting the fprintf_function typedef out
      into its own header so other headers can get at it without having
      to include qemu-common.h.

      target-xtensa: add 64-bit floating point registers · ddd44279
      Max Filippov 提交于
      Xtensa ISA got specification for 64-bit floating point registers and
      opcodes, see ISA, 4.3.11 "Floating point coprocessor option".
      
      Add 64-bit FP registers.
      
      Although 64-bit floating point is currently not supported by xtensa
      translator, these registers need to be reported to gdb with proper size,
      otherwise it wouldn't find other registers.

      arm_mptimer: Fix timer shutdown and mode change · 8a52340c
      Dmitry Osipenko 提交于
      The running timer can't be stopped because timer control code just
      doesn't handle disabling the timer. Fix it by deleting the timer if
      the enable bit is cleared.
      
      The timer won't start periodic ticking if a ONE-SHOT -> PERIODIC mode
      change happens after a one-shot tick was completed. Fix it by
      re-starting ticking if the timer isn't ticking right now.
      
      To avoid code churning, these two fixes are squashed in one commit.

      hw/intc/arm_gic_common.c: Reset all registers · 12dc273e
      Peter Maydell 提交于
      The arm_gic_common reset function was missing reset code for
      several of the GIC's state fields:
       * bpr[]
       * abpr[]
       * priority1[]
       * priority2[]
       * sgi_pending[]
       * irq_target[] (SMP configurations only)
      
      These probably went unnoticed because most guests will either
      never touch them, or will write to them in the process of
      configuring the GIC before enabling interrupts.

      target-arm: Split DISAS_YIELD from DISAS_WFE · 049e24a1
      Peter Maydell 提交于
      Currently we use DISAS_WFE for both WFE and YIELD instructions.
      This is functionally correct because at the moment both of them
      are implemented as "yield this CPU back to the top level loop so
      another CPU has a chance to run". However it's rather confusing
      that YIELD ends up calling HELPER(wfe), and if we ever want to
      implement real behaviour for WFE and SEV it's likely to trip us up.
      
      Split out the yield codepath to use DISAS_YIELD and a new
      HELPER(yield) function, and have HELPER(wfe) call HELPER(yield).

      target-arm: fix write helper for TLBI ALLE1IS · 2a6332d9
      Sergey Fedorov 提交于
      TLBI ALLE1IS is an operation that does invalidate TLB entries on all PEs
      in the same Inner Sharable domain, not just on the current CPU. So we
      must use tlbiall_is_write() here.
